  • What does "buy" mean in MKC activity?

    "Buy" means an investor increased their reported position in MKC compared to the prior reporting period. This reflects growing exposure to MCCORMICK & CO-NON VTG SHRS (MKC) rather than necessarily a brand-new position (though new positions also appear as buys when prior quantity was zero).
